NFLT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review
22 of the 4,364 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Virtus Newfleet Multi-Sector Bond ETF (NFLT)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$128M — down 9.6% from $142M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 3 funds opened new NFLT posit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 3 added to existing stakes and 12 trimmed.
The largest buyer was First Capital Advisors Group, adding an estimated $293K. The largest seller was Aviance Capital Management, cutting an estimated $6.86M.
